Instructions

  • Step 1: Make eyeballs Make a bleeding eyeball cupcake: Put a green, candy in the center of a vanilla- or cream cheese-frosted cupcake and stick a chocolate chip into the middle. Then mix some red food coloring into a small batch of white frosting and use it to pipe wiggly lines outward from the eyeball.
  • TIP: Stick a chocolate chip-stuffed mini-marshmallow onto a piece of red shoestring licorice to make a dangling eyeball cupcake topper.
  • Step 2: Create creepy crawlies Make a long-legged spider: start with a chocolate-frosted cupcake, cover the top with chocolate sprinkles, and add two red candies for eyes. Insert four 3-inch pieces of black shoestring licorice on either side of the eyes for legs.
  • Step 3: Go with a ghost To make a ghost cupcake, pipe vanilla frosting onto a cupcake in the shape of a soft-serve ice cream swirl, about 1 1/2 inches high, and use mini-chocolate chips for eyes.
  • TIP: Add an unwrapped chocolate coin to some of the cupcakes as a mouth.
  • Step 4: Design jack-o’-lantern Design jack-o’-lanterns: make orange icing, then use a craft knife to carve black licorice nibs or chocolate bars into eyes, mouths, and stems.
  • TIP: If you want green stems, cut candied lime slices or fruit roll-ups into the appropriate shape.
  • Step 5: Dig your own grave Turn a chocolate-frosted cupcake into a gravesite by piping “RIP” on an oval-shaped cookie and standing it up into one end of the cupcake. Spread crumbled graham crackers in front of the headstone to represent a mound of freshly dug dirt. Happy Halloween!
  • FACT: Black cats are associated with Halloween because they were once believed to be witches’ assistants, or even witches in disguise.

You Will Need

  • Cupcakes
  • Vanilla or cream cheese frosting
  • Green candies
  • Food coloring
  • Piping tools
  • Chocolate chips
  • Chocolate frosting
  • Chocolate sprinkles
  • Small red candies
  • Black shoestring licorice
  • Craft knife
  • Black licorice nibs or chocolate bars
  • Oval-shaped cookies
  • Graham crackers
  • Mini marshmellows (optional)
  • Red shoestring licorice (optional)
  • Chocolate coins (optional)
  • Candied lime slices or fruit leather (optional)

How to Make Lollipop Ghosts for Halloween https://howcast.com/videos/399083-how-to-make-lollipop-ghosts-for-halloween/ Tue, 27 Jul 2010 11:16:02 +0000 https://howcast.com/videos/399083-how-to-make-lollipop-ghosts-for-halloween/

Instructions

  • Step 1: Place tissue over lollipop Place a white tissue over the lollipop to create the head of the ghost.
  • Step 2: Secure tissue Secure the tissue with a piece of string or ribbon at the base of the lollipop.
  • TIP: Use traditional Halloween colors, such as black or orange, for the string.
  • Step 3: Draw a face Draw a silly or scary face on the tissue with a black marker.
  • Step 4: Put the lollipops in a bowl Put the lollipops in a candy bowl and wait for the kids to yell “trick or treat!”
  • FACT: Studies show that 34 percent of Americans believe in ghosts.

You Will Need

  • Round lollipops
  • White tissue
  • String or ribbon
  • Black marker
  • Candy bowl

How To Make Scary Desserts For Halloween https://howcast.com/videos/395700-how-to-make-scary-desserts-for-halloween/ Mon, 26 Jul 2010 12:16:01 +0000 https://howcast.com/videos/395700-how-to-make-scary-desserts-for-halloween/

Instructions

  • Step 1: Make edible eyeballs Make edible eyeballs by melting the white chocolate over low heat and then dipping the doughnut holes into the chocolate.
  • TIP: Tap off excess chocolate.
  • Step 2: Push chocolate chip in doughnut Push the tip of a chocolate chip into the doughnut to for a pupil and then place the eyeballs on parchment paper to dry.
  • Step 3: Draw red veins Use the red decorator frosting to make squiggly veins in the eyeballs and enjoy your gross looking treats — no tricks needed.
  • Step 4: Make creepy looking jigglers Make creepy looking jigglers by making the gelatin according to package directions.
  • Step 5: Pour into pan Pour the gelatin into the pan, and refrigerate it for 3 hours. Then dip the bottom of the pan in warm water for 15 seconds to loosen the gelatin
  • Step 6: Use cookie cutters Cut the gelatin into scary shapes with Halloween themed cookie cutters. You will get many “ooos” and “ahhs” with these treats.
  • FACT: The earliest celebrations of Halloween date back to the Celtic people who lived in what is now Great Britain and Northern France, over 2,000 years ago.

You Will Need

  • 2 11-ounce bags white chocolate chips
  • 12 doughnut holes
  • 12 semisweet chocolate chips
  • 1 tube red decorator frosting
  • 2 packages 8-serving size flavored gelatin
  • Parchment paper
  • 13 x 9-in. pan
  • Halloween themed cookie cutters
